#137c36 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#137c36 is composed of 7.5% red, 48.6%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 56.5%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 140 degrees, a saturation of 73.4% and a lightness of 28%. #137c36 color hex could be obtained by blending #26f86c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

#137c36 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#137c36 has RGB values of R:19, G:124, B:54 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0, Y:0.56,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 1276982.
